Sullana Province, Peru Vacation Guide
Sullana Province, located in the Piura Region of Peru, is a vibrant destination that offers a unique blend of cultural experiences, natural beauty, and warm hospitality. Established as a province in the early 20th century, Sullana has grown to become a bustling hub with a population of approximately 200,000 residents. The province is characterized by its rich agricultural landscape, friendly communities, and a variety of attractions that cater to both locals and tourists alike. Best Time to Visit Sullana Province
When planning a vacation to Sullana Province, timing is crucial to ensure you enjoy the best weather and activities the region has to offer. The climate in Sullana is generally warm and dry, making it an appealing destination year-round. The average temperature typically hovers around 25°C (77°F), with daytime highs reaching up to 30°C (86°F) during the warmer months. The evenings are pleasantly cooler, providing a comfortable atmosphere for outdoor activities and exploration.
The best time to visit Sullana is during the dry season, which spans from May to October. During these months, you can expect minimal rainfall and plenty of sunshine, perfect for outdoor adventures and sightseeing. The wet season, from November to April, brings occasional showers, but it also transforms the landscape into a lush paradise, making it an excellent time for those who appreciate nature's beauty. Top Sights of Sullana Province
Sullana Province is rich in history, culture, and natural beauty, offering a variety of sights that are sure to captivate visitors. Here are five top places to visit during your stay in Sullana:
Plaza de Armas: The heart of Sullana, this central square is surrounded by beautiful colonial architecture and is a great place to relax, people-watch, and enjoy local street food.
Sullana Cathedral: An architectural gem, this historic cathedral features stunning design elements and serves as a focal point for the local community.
Chira River: A picturesque spot for nature lovers, the Chira River offers opportunities for fishing, kayaking, and enjoying scenic picnics along its banks.
Las Huaringas Lagoons: Located a short drive from Sullana, these stunning lagoons are known for their healing properties and are a popular destination for those seeking relaxation and rejuvenation.
Cerro de la Paz: This hill offers panoramic views of the surrounding landscape and is a great spot for hiking and photography, especially during sunrise or sunset.
